May 21, 2020In its aim to develop high-performance, long-lasting, and robust lighting solutions, LUBO Lighting, a Canadian landscaping and architectural lighting developer and manufacturer, is proud to present its new state-of-the-art VEGALux system.
Featuring three light bulb variations for MR16: VEGALux 336L, 680L and 1500L, all variations feature:
- Top Lumen performance, up to 1500L
- Exclusive use of LUBO’s aluminum fixture with minimal footprint (lightweight, 2,5’’ diameter, retrofit),
- Patented thermo transfer technology,
- Extended bulb lifetime (60 000 hours),
- 4 interchangeable optics.
Those 3 VEGALux variations have been developed for lighting enthusiasts seeking innovative environmentally optimized solutions for their outdoor lighting needs.
“The VEGALux System is the only lighting system on the market, that combines high performance lumen capacity to up to 1500L and retrofit fixtures at minimal footprint”, declares LUBO Lighting’s president, Bertrand Ouellet. “The VEGALux System features in a minimalist retrofit form with full customization abilities, made with the best thermal transfer material on the market: Aluminum 6061T5. The lighting fixture’s combined weight is only 13.8 oz representing two to three times less raw material than other spotlights”.
VEGALlux System includes 3 variations of light bulbs with 4 optic lenses each: 336L, 680L and 1500L including 6 pre-set dimming levels. All those functions have been developed for upmost versatility. The Beard and the Respiratory Protection Mask
Half-masks and full-facepiece respirators require an optimal seal to guarantee their effectiveness, and the beard can impede it considerably.
DID YOU KNOW THAT A BEARD’S REGROWTH AS LITTLE AS ONE DAY OLD CAN AFFECT THE MASK’S SEAL IN PLACE?
What does it mean exactly?
Since many masks have been tested on different face types, the results of these tests vary considerably. However, it should be noted that in 100% of cases, after 7 days without shaving, the respiratory protection masks showed a leak of more than 1%. This means that the air inside the mask contained more than 1% of unwanted particles!
Signify LytePro LED Wall Pack Gen 3
Providing high quality illumination, LytePro’s low profile design complements and blends in with its surroundings. Available in 3 sizes, LytePro offers two optical distributions, multiple lumen packages, and is suitable for a range of mounting heights.
Lumen output ranges from 1,000 to 9,600 with efficacies up to 114 LPW, and all models are DLC qualified. The LPW32 even features button photocell, motion response, battery pack, and field adjustable wattage options.

Taking a Closer Look at the Trilliant Libra Smart Meter with Steven Lupo
By Blake Marchand
Trilliant, an international provider of utility solutions for advanced metering and smart grid systems, recently announced a custom-made product for the North American market with the release of its Trilliant Libra Series Edge-Ready Smart Electric Meter.
The meter’s technology will allow utilities to enter the connectivity sphere by providing peer-to-peer data acquisition and analytics, while enabling new energy management features that benefit both customer and utility.
